John Polkinghorne was a distinguished English theoretical physicist and Anglican priest, whose life bridged the realms of science and faith. Born on October 16, 1930, in Weston-super-Mare, he earned acclaim for his work in particle physics before embracing theology, which culminated in his ordination in 1982. Polkinghorne's contributions extend beyond academia; he authored numerous books exploring the dialogue between science and religion, making profound insights into the compatibility of both fields. His legacy remains a testament to the harmonious relationship between faith and rational inquiry.
